How to Kill Epsilons with a Dagger - INRIA - Institut National de Recherche en Informatique et en Automatique Accéder directement au contenu
Communication Dans Un Congrès Année : 2014

How to Kill Epsilons with a Dagger

Résumé

We propose an abstract framework for modeling state-based systems with internal behavior as e.g. given by silent or ϵ -transitions. Our approach employs monads with a parametrized fixpoint operator to give a semantics to those systems and implement a sound procedure of abstraction of the internal transitions, whose labels are seen as the unit of a free monoid. More broadly, our approach extends the standard coalgebraic framework for state-based systems by taking into account the algebraic structure of the labels of their transitions. This allows to consider a wide range of other examples, including Mazurkiewicz traces for concurrent systems.
Fichier principal
Vignette du fichier
328263_1_En_4_Chapter.pdf (393.69 Ko) Télécharger le fichier
Origine : Fichiers produits par l'(les) auteur(s)
Loading...

Dates et versions

hal-01408752 , version 1 (05-12-2016)

Licence

Paternité

Identifiants

Citer

Filippo Bonchi, Stefan Milius, Alexandra Silva, Fabio Zanasi. How to Kill Epsilons with a Dagger. 12th International Workshop on Coalgebraic Methods in Computer Science (CMCS), Apr 2014, Grenoble, France. pp.53-74, ⟨10.1007/978-3-662-44124-4_4⟩. ⟨hal-01408752⟩
438 Consultations
94 Téléchargements

Altmetric

Partager

Gmail Facebook X LinkedIn More